<br />1. The place of business covered by the permit shall not be located within <br />300 feet of a residence located within a zoning district that limits density to 6 units <br />per acre or less. It is unlawful for a person to sell or engage in the business of selling <br />any alcoholic beverages for on-premises consumption where the place of business is <br />located within 300 feet of a church, public school, or public hospital. The <br />measurement of the distance between a place of business where alcoholic beverages <br />are sold and the church, ef public hospital or residence shall be along the property <br />lines of street fronts and from front door to front door, and in a direct line across <br />street intersections. The measurement of the distance from a place of business where <br />alcoholic bevemges are sold and the public schools shall be in a direct line from the <br />property line of the place of business, and in a direct line across intersections. <br /> <br />2. If a residence, church, public school, or public hospital locates within 300 <br />feet of an establishment with a T ABC specific use permit after the permit is issued, <br />the permitted establishment shall not be considered to be out of compliance with this <br />chapter. <br /> <br />******* <br /> <br />k.
